給定一個數組,判斷該數組中是否含有。若有,輸出該數組中所有重復的元素,返回true;若無,返回false。 示例,如下數組numbers,輸出[2,3,5],返回true 1.思路 現將數組numbers按照從小到大進行排序(從大到小亦可),然后依次比較相鄰的兩個元素 ...
算法一:比較常見,也比較容易想到。缺點:如果arrA中有重復元素,那么重復的元素只會輸出一次。 int arrA , , , , , int arrB new int arrA.length 用來存儲arrA中出現過的元素 .做一個arrA.length次數的循環 .生成隨機數index,范圍 , 對應arrA中元素的索引值 .生成一個方法,判斷arrA index 是否存在於arrB中, 如果不 ...
2019-05-02 13:34 0 541 推薦指數:
給定一個數組,判斷該數組中是否含有。若有,輸出該數組中所有重復的元素,返回true;若無,返回false。 示例,如下數組numbers,輸出[2,3,5],返回true 1.思路 現將數組numbers按照從小到大進行排序(從大到小亦可),然后依次比較相鄰的兩個元素 ...
<!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title> ...
var newArr = []; for (var index in arr) { var isFind = false; ...
通過使用/etc/passwd 文件,getent命令,compgen命令這三種方法查看系統中用戶的信息。 Linux 系統中用戶信息存放在/etc/passwd文件中。 這是一個包含每個用戶基本信息的文本文件。當我們在系統中創建一個用戶,新用戶的詳細信息就會被添加到這個文件中 ...
大家都知道,Linux 系統中用戶信息存放在 /etc/passwd 文件中。 這是一個包含每個用戶基本信息的文本文件。當我們在系統中創建一個用戶,新用戶的詳細信息就會被添加到這個文件中。 /et ...
//去除數組中重復元素 var arr = [0,2,3,1,5,5,8,8,2,1,10,10,43,43]; var json = {}; for (var i = 0; i < arr.length; i++) { if (!json[arr[i]]) { json[arr[i ...
//獲取數組內所有重復元素,並以數組返回 //例:入參數組['1','2','4','7','1','2','2'] 返回數組:['1','2'] function GetRepeatFwxmmc(ary1){ var ary = ary1.sort();//數組排序 var ...
問題描述: 求一個集合中所有子集元素之和。如{1,2,3,4,5,6,7,8,9,10……n} 算法分析: 由於集合中元素具有無序性, 所以集合中每個元素在子集中出現的次數是相同的。這樣的話,問題就簡單了,求所有子集元素的和就可以簡化為求每個元素在子集中出現的次數*全集中所有元素的和。全集中所有 ...